Rising gracefully along the coastline of Casablanca, Morocco, the Hassan II Mosque is a breathtaking architectural masterpiece. As the largest mosque in both Morocco and Africa, it features the world’s tallest minaret, soaring to an astounding 210 meters (689 feet). More than just a striking landmark, the mosque stands as a powerful symbol of Morocco’s deep-rooted cultural heritage and spiritual identity.

The Sacred Heart Cathedral, an impressive Roman Catholic church, rises with grandeur in the center of Casablanca. With its bold neo-Gothic design and radiant white façade, it stands as a striking city landmark—an enduring symbol of Casablanca’s architectural elegance and historical depth.
Mohamed V Square pulses at the center of Casablanca’s energy, attracting visitors from all over the world. Surrounded by fluttering pigeons and constant activity, this lively plaza offers an authentic window into daily life in the city. Dedicated to King Mohamed V, it stands as both a historic landmark and a popular gathering place where locals and tourists come together to experience the spirit of Casablanca.
The Casablanca Corniche is a vibrant and captivating coastal promenade that stretches along the Atlantic Ocean. This bustling area is lined with a variety of cafes, restaurants, and inviting beaches, providing stunning panoramic views and a lively atmosphere perfect for relaxation and socializing.
